UCLA Basketball Seeks Transfer Portal Forwards After Tyler Bilodeau Exit

UCLA basketball faces a crucial offseason after losing forward Tyler Bilodeau, who was a significant contributor to the team. The Bruins coaching staff is now targeting multiple forwards through the college transfer portal to fill the gap.

Among the potential recruits is a player named Royal, who brings strong rebounding and scoring skills. While Royal doesn't match Bilodeau's shooting ability, he offers the physical presence UCLA needs in the frontcourt. Scouts believe another year of development could make Royal one of the top forwards in the Big Ten.

Another target is Dedan Thomas Jr., who ranks as the No. 5 overall transfer prospect according to recruiting services. The Bruins are competing with other major programs to secure these players before the start of the new season.

UCLA's success in the transfer portal will be critical as they prepare for Big Ten conference play. The team needs forwards who can both score and rebound effectively to replace Bilodeau's production.
